Live Cannibalism
Release Date: Sep 26, 2000
Label: Metal Blade
Genres: Heavy Metal, Death Metal/Black Metal
Number Of Tracks: 18
Live Cannibalism is Cannibal Corpse's first live album, recorded in 2000 at venues in Milwaukee and Indianapolis.

Sound: What to say, what to say. I know! How about, one of the best live albums I have ever heard! Not only do they out do themselves, but they play the best CC songs! It's almost like a best hits CD except live! The sound is terrific and grips your very soul and takes it on a roller coaster of gore and mayhem! No muffled guitars, no muffled drums, and you can hear every pitch of George Fischers gutterals! There is nothing, and I mean nothing, wrong with the sound of this album! // 10

Lyrics and Singing: There were two questions going through my mind as I listened to this album. How does George keep a steady gutteral, and does he even remember the words to the songs he is singing? I mean, the guy has terrific vocals, but hearing every pitch of his voice in this album is not a great thing. Including the fact that he can't remember the words to the songs. He remembered all in F--ked With A Knife, but all the others, it just seems he had a little too much alcohol before going on stage (if he had any). But without his gutterals, there wouldn't be Cannibal Corpse and this would just be an instrumental album, which isn't too much of a bad thing, espescially if you like to listen and play guitar. But I like George a little more than Chris Barnes so I'll go easy. // 7

Impression: Overall, I have the biggest whiplash and I can't stop listening to this album! Remember how KISS became noticed? It was with a live album. Now if CC isn't noticed by now by the general public, this might be the CD to change all that, if people wern't so damn controversial about the lyrics. If you are a big fan of CC, I will guess you already got this album, if not go get it! And if you are a death metal fan looking for a good CD, buy this one! It will give you the time of your life! // 10
